Here are some examples of the contributions of Thomas Jefferson and Benjamin Franklin during the Revolutionary War:

- Thomas Jefferson: As a member of the Continental Congress, Jefferson drafted the Declaration of Independence in 1776, which became a rallying cry for American independence. He also served as the Governor of Virginia during the war and supported various measures to strengthen the American cause.

- Benjamin Franklin: Franklin played a crucial role in diplomatic efforts during the Revolutionary War. He traveled to Europe and secured support from countries like France, which aided the American colonies with military supplies and troops. Franklin also helped negotiate the Treaty of Paris in 1783, which officially ended the war.
